Leicester City manager Brendan Rodgers has spoken about a return date for striker Jamie Vardy.

The attacker went through surgery on a long term hernia problem on Saturday.

The club wants to get him fully fit, rather than risk the issue getting worse. But Vardy could be back in training within 10 days.

Rodgers said in his post-match press conference: "He had the operation yesterday (Saturday). Jamie was supposed to have this operation before the last round, when we played against Stoke but unfortunately the surgeon wasn't able to do the surgery then, so we had to put it back a few weeks. He had it yesterday.

"The reason for doing it was because we felt it would be a week to 10 days maximum before he was back on the pitch, and then probably another few days before he would be available. That was the two-week timeline we looked at.

"He won't lose too much fitness. It's only a minor operation. We can cope without him at this point, and then he will be fit and raring to go for the remainder of the season."
